The Best Poem Of Jane Bennett

Loss Of Hope

Seems like just yesterday i was only eight
didn't have to worry about my makeup or my weight

This bittersweet is now left bitter
These words a write, a depression transmitter

I've lost hope, my faith
There's nothing left
I only hope tomorrow will end with my death

If i can't look forward to tomorrow
Whats the point of today?
I want nothing more than to leave
but something makes me stay

What do you call it when you feel this much pain?
Im trying to win, yet there's nothing to gain

I tried telling you my problems
i thought you would know best
but you avoid my presence
I'm feeling so depressed

You said it was a phase
blame my past life for it all
you would listen to what i say
I know, its all my fault
